The recent development of computation and automation has lead to quick advances in the theory and practice of recursive methods for stabilization, identification and control of complex stochastic models (guiding a rocket or a plane, organizing multiaccess broadcast channels, self-learning of neural networks ...). This book provides an up-to-date view of a wide range of those methods: stochastic approximation, linear and non-linear models, controlled Markov chains, estimation and adaptive control, learning ... Mathematicians (researchers and also students) and engineers will find here a self-contained account of many approaches to those theories.
